4 comments about Intelligent Poker: Texas Hold'em.
- This is an outstanding overview of Texas Hold'em poker. I wish I had read it before reading longer books on the game. Braids provides a compact and clear explanation of Hold'em and the thought processes needed for each stage of a hand. His discussion of the five decision factors is actually applicable to all forms of poker. The charts and illustrations are helpful. More complex books on Hold'em make much more sense after reading Braid's book. Also if you play poker online, having the chart on page 22 taped above your computer screen is helpful for knowing when to stay in a hand after the flop.
- It is hard to imagine a [price] book being overpriced, but this one is. If you have never played Hold'em at any level, this MAY be a place to start, but even for that it is totally inadequate. There are dozens of better choices available. Save your money.
- I find this a very helpful summary of Texas Hold'em. I travel by bus to Atlantic City every couple months to play Hold'em and I carry this book along to review on the bus. I own a lot of poker books and have studied them all. However for a quick summary of Hold'em basics before sitting down to play, this book is what I use. The list of the five decision factors reminds me of where I should focus my thoughts during play. I like to review the tables and charts too.

5 comments about Ace on the River: An Advanced Poker Guide (Unabridged).
- it actually write all bout the philosophy about poker and it teaches u to be a better poker players before or after u win the game !!!!
- This book is far and away some of the best stuff that has been written on poker. I lost my copy and this book is so chalked full of info I had to buy it again! Barry Greenstein is the consummate professional and an excellent writer on top of that.
For those that like hand charts and theorem like explanations of how to play poker, you will not like this book.
For those that want the wisdom of one of pokers finest players, you will not be disappointed. Barry understands that a thorough understanding of mathematics and of poker is more the ludic elements that make up the physical game.
- So I won't rehash what has been said in the other reviews. But the following hasn't really been emphasized:
This book is BEAUTIFUL. It's a large oversized "quarto" trade paperback, with extraordinarily thick and glossy pages, bound together beautifully. It's been a very very long time since a book at this price point was made this nicely. I would suggest buying it, just to have such a nice looking book.
- This book is different from the usual play these starting hands only type poker instruction manuals. There is a lot of interesting and useful insight into life and thoughts of a high limit poker player.
The top review on the page said it was too brief about the math and starting hands, I say BRAVO, I have had enough of that information and this was definitely a refreshing work for a person who owns several books and dvds by professionals on how to play (Hold Em).
GREAT WORK. I only gave it 4 stars simply because I didnt want anyone to think that I just slapped them on there because I liked the book. I read this almost 300 page book in 2 days(its really about 250 pages because theres a lot of photos and stuff, but they were not overdone IMHO)
- This book is excellent for any poker player looking to make the move from casual play to a more serious game. Barry Greenstein discusses what it takes to make a living from playing poker, including bankroll management, game selection, what makes a great all-around poker player, and how to balance poker with the rest of your life.
One of the most helpful aspects of this book was how Barry describes the mentality of a poker player. His advice helps you deal with bad beats, getting outdrawn on, and all the other perils of playing poker.
Also included in the book are example hands, presented in a "what would you do?" format. Barry then discusses his play and what he was thinking in many key hands of his poker career.
